1) For US. Inc., there have been having problems with deciding on the number of Kanban cards in the system. There were several material shortages during the last period. In order to prevent shortages while maintaining an efficient Kanban system, how many Kanban cards should be released in the system?

The lead time is 1 day and the safety stock level is set to 10% of the average demand during the day. The container size is 15 units per container. The following is the demands over the last 10 days:

Days

1

2

3

4

5

6

7

8

9

10

Daily demands

100

98

97

120

123

125

121

100

110

105

Select one:

a. 15 cards

b. 8 cards

c. 5 cards

d. 12 cards

Explanation / Answer

y = (DT(1+x))/C=110x1(1+.1)/15=8 cards

Average demand=1099/10=110 rounded off

Y: number of cards

D: demand per unit of time

T: lead time

C: container capacity

X: buffer, or safety factor
